Horace E. Mahorney

Chemical EngineerOak Ridge, TN

University of California, BerkeleyY-12 Plant
Manhattan Project Veteran
Y-12 Calutron Girls

Horace Mahorney was a chemical engineer at the Y-12 plant in Oak Ridge, Tennessee. From September 1943 to November 1945, Mahorney was an operator of the mass spectrometer with Dr. Oliver Loud. Mahorney had come from the University of California at Berkeley to help draft an operational guide for Building 2 at the Y-12 Plant.
